  15. I'm reminded of the Cantina band figure situation in the Black series. High priced deluxe figure with three instruments and swappable hands on Pulse and a lower priced version of the figure with three different instruments for retail. A lot of collectors figured out that if they wanted the whole band, they could save money by just ordering one of the higher priced deluxe figures and multiples of the regular retail figure.

  19. Medicom figures are typically true 1:12 scale (Legends are actually closer 1:11), so they're almost always smaller.
